Medical Disposable Surgical Absorbable Monofilament Sterile Catgut Chromic Suture
Description
Catgut Chromic (CC) Suture is a sterile absorbable monofilament suture composed of purified collagen derived from either the serosal layer of beef (bovine) or the submucosal fibrous layer of sheep (ovine) intestines. The CC Suture undergoes a ribbon stage chromicisation and is treated with glycerin. It is treated with chromic salt solutions and offers a longer stitch holds time and larger resistance to absorption compared to Catgut Plain. Where there is an increased level of proteolytic enzymes present, as in the secretions exhibited in the stomach, cervix and vagina, Catgut Sutures are absorbed more rapidly. The CC Suture is packed in tubing fluid and available undyed from sizes: USP6/0 – USP3. CC Sutures fulfils all the requirements of USP and the European Pharmacopoeia for sterile and absorbable sutures.
Indications
CC Sutures are indicated for use in general surgery. It is suitable for use in soft tissue and for ligation, including use in ophthalmic procedures, but not for cardiovascular and neurological tissues.
Action
CC Sutures procedures minimum acute tissue reactions followed. Catgut Chromic Sutures have a high initial tensile strength, which is retained for up to 28 days. After which absorption by enzymatic digestive process dissolves the surgical gut. The process of digestion is completed by 90 days. Contraindications: The CC Sutures are absorbable and should not be used where long suture support is necessary.
Adverse Events / complications
Wound dehiscence, enhanced bacterial infectivity, infection and transitory local irritation.
Warning Notes
This product must not be re-sterilized. If the Suture sachet is damaged it must be discarded.The CC Sutures should be stored in a dry room, not exposed to direct sunlight or extreme temperatures. Carefully observe the expiry date.As this is an absorbable suture material, the use of supplemental non-absorbable sutures should be considered by the surgeon in closure of the abdomen, chest, joints or other sites subject to expansion or requiring additional support.
